He Sees AllBy Anne Elliott, October 3, 2014, ElliottExpedition.com In 2014, we felt God calling us to leave our home in Wisconsin and travel to places unknown to start Sabbath fellowships wherever we could. We sold all our stuff, bought a bus, and started the process of fixing it up as our home. That whole summer we lived in tents as we did construction on the bus. In the fall, we traveled to
Michigan, where dear friends let us stay with them while we continued working on the bus. However, through a series of problems and obstacles, we began to realize that maybe what God wanted was for us to stay in Michigan and start a congregation right there. Continue
